Introduction
Edgar F. Codd, 1970
One sentence to explain relational database model:
Data are organized in relations (tables),which are linked (relationship) by keys
Relation
A relation is a two-dimensional table that has specific characteristics: The table consist of rows and columns Rows contain data about an entity instances All values in a row describes the same
entity instance Columns contain data about attributes of
the entity All values in a column are of the same kind
Relation (continued)
Relation’s specific characteristics go on: Cells of the table hold a single value Each row is distinct Each column has a unique name The order of the rows is unimportant The order of the columns is
unimportant

Keys
A key is one or more columns of a relation that is used to identify a record Primary key Foreign key
Primary Key
Primary key The value of this key column uniquely
identifies a single record (row) There is only one primary key for a table
Candidate Key A candidate to become the primary key There can be multiple candidate keys for a
table

Composite Key
A key that contains two or more attributes (columns)
Example “FirstName” + “LastName” “FirstName” + “LastName” + “BirthDate” “FirstName” + “LastName” + “BirthDate” +
“BirthCity” …
Surrogate Key/Artificial Key
It’s a key created arbitrarily to replace the natural key Typically used in place of a composite key Usually it has no real meaning
Example We can create a “ReviewID” in the
“BookReviews” table to replace the original composite key
Relationship and Foreign Key
Relationship defines how tables (relations) are linked
Two tables are linked by a pair of keys The primary key of one table The foreign key in the linked table These two keys are of the same kind

Relationship Types
One-to-one Example: students and GSU network
accounts
One-to-many Example: students and diplomas
*Many-to-many Example: students and professors
Referential Integrity
Every value of a foreign key must match a value of the primary key
For example (“Premiere Products” database) In “Customer” table, “RepNum” is a foreign
key (linked to the “Rep” table where “RepNum” is the primary key).
Then every value of “RepNum” in the “Customer” table must exist in the “Rep” table
